Prior to starting psychotherapy, most clients question, "Will this therapy actually aid me with my issues?" Research shows that several variables influence whether therapy is effective, including the extent of the problem(s) being treated, the individual's idea that the counseling will function and the skill degree of the therapist. However, research study over the previous fifty years has demonstrated that a person factor even more than any kind of other is related to successful therapy: the top quality of the connection in between the specialist and the patient.


Since that time, research has actually revealed that the quality of this relationship (the "restorative partnership," as it is called) is the best forecaster of whether or not therapy succeeds. Noticeably, the quality of the healing relationship shows up essential to treatment success no issue what kind of treatment is studied.


patient or specialist records or observational scores). These researches, which used diverse patient groups (youngsters and adults, in-patients and out-patients) dealt with for all sorts of troubles (i.e. depression, stress and anxiety, drug misuse, job and social troubles), all reveal the importance of the restorative connection on therapy end result. "A little over fifty percent of the valuable effects of therapy made up [in previous study] are connected to the quality of the alliance," according to Dr.

Remarkably sufficient, patients and therapists usually (however not constantly) settle on the quality of their partnership. Nevertheless, it is the person's assumption of the high quality of the partnership that is the toughest predictor of therapy success. Individuals' rankings of their connection with the specialist, even extremely early in the therapy after the first session or more anticipate their improvement over the program of treatment.


When problems emerge, can the therapist and person share any type of adverse feelings, pain or anger that may have resulted? And, can they collaborate to solve any kind of issues that may occur in their collaborate? William Pinsof shows the significance of increasing this definition to consist of the influence of substantial various other individuals in the person's life. For instance, in individual therapy, support of the therapy by the patient's better halves (household participants, spouse, friends) was related to successful result. In pair therapy, the degree to which the pair agreed with each various other on therapy tasks, objectives and bonds predicted whether look at this site therapy would be effective.


Several beginning therapists are as knowledgeable as their more skilled counterparts at creating great therapeutic relationships. Nevertheless, research studies reveal that experienced therapists are better at forming relationships with those patients who have battled in previous connections. On top of that, experienced therapists are better than novices at recognizing and fixing problems in the healing partnership.
